Cove Capital Investments Continues to Expand Its Delaware Statutory Trust Portfolio with the Acquisition of Its Cove San Antonio Multifamily 119 DST - a 170-Unit Multifamily Community
Why this matters
Cove Capital’s acquisition of a 170-unit multifamily community in San Antonio via a lender’s REO disposition underscores several institutional trends in US commercial real estate. The deal, executed below appraised value and loan balance, highlights ongoing distress-driven opportunities in the multifamily sector, a segment traditionally viewed as a defensive asset class. This transaction signals that despite broader macroeconomic pressures and tighter lending conditions, capital remains poised to deploy selectively into assets with embedded value through lender workouts. For institutional investors, the use of a Delaware Statutory Trust (DST) structure to facilitate a 1031 exchange reflects continued demand for tax-efficient vehicles that enable portfolio repositioning without immediate capital gains exposure. The choice of San Antonio, a market with favorable demographic and economic fundamentals, suggests a preference for Sun Belt multifamily assets that offer both income stability and growth potential amid uneven market dynamics. More broadly, this deal illustrates how capital is navigating a bifurcated landscape: while new construction and speculative development face headwinds, opportunistic acquisitions sourced from lender REO pipelines provide a pathway to accretive entry points. The transaction thus serves as a barometer for how institutional capital is calibrating risk and liquidity in a complex financing environment.
